bashスクリプトを使用してGNOMEシェルのテーマを変更するには?

bashスクリプトを使用してGNOMEシェルのテーマを変更するには?

特定の時間に明るいテーマと暗いテーマを自動的に変更するスクリプトを作成したいと思います。 gtkテーマを変更しましたが、シェルテーマを変更する方法が見つかりませんでした。どんな助けでも大変感謝します。

更新:だから私は次のコードを試しましたが、それでも機能しません。

gsettings set org.gnome.shell.extensions.user-theme name "Vimix-Light"

ベストアンサー1

さて、上記のコードがうまくいかないのは、次のファイルが原因です。"org.gnome.extensions.user-theme.gschema.xml"行方不明"/usr/share/glib-2.0/schemas/"

問題を解決するには、次のコードを実行してください。

sudo cp $HOME/.local/share/gnome-shell/extensions/[email protected]/schemas/org.gnome.shell.extensions.user-theme.gschema.xml /usr/share/glib-2.0/schemas
sudo glib-compile-schemas /usr/share/glib-2.0/schemas

おすすめ記事